Map of the known distribution for Exocnophila species, in southeast Brazil. Precise localities are known only for Rio de Janeiro state; the inlet map shows Brazilian states with records for the genus highlighted in red, map colours indicating biomes (dark green: Amazon, green: Atlantic Forest; orange: Cerrado; beige: Caatinga).
